Tax Administration Liaison Committee (TALC)

The function of the Main TALC Committee is to review and make recommendations to achieve more effective and efficient administration of:

  • direct taxes (Income Tax, Capital Gains Tax, Corporation Tax, Capital Acquisitions Tax)
  • stamp duties
  • and
  • Value-Added Tax.

The recommendations relate to either administrative practices of the Office of the Revenue Commissioners or of tax practitioners.

Terms of reference

The permanent members of TALC are the:

  • Revenue Commissioners
  • Irish Taxation Institute
  • Consultative Committee of Accountancy Bodies – Ireland
  • Law Society.

TALC consists of main TALC and several standing sub-committees.
